Tavoitteet
After completing this course, the student is able to
- identify Asset-based Community Development theories and methods
- apply Asset-based Community Development methods in practice
- analyse and apply different communal and empowering methods  
- analyse and evaluate participatory approaches to community development
- implement the practitioner research in community development
                    
Sisältö
- Models of communal work: biography, exposure, social analysis, conviviality, use your talents
- Asset-based community development theories and practices 
- Asset-based community development and the sustainable future
- Inclusivity in Asset-based Community Development
- Youth participation in community development
- Capacity building and empowerment
- The role of local faith-based actors in community development

We offer a unique opportunity to participate in the Asset-based Community Development Erasmus+ Blended Intensive Programme (BIP) and learn from experts from different countries. Asset-based Community Development BIP is offered jointly with Diak’s partner HEIs Technical University of Applied Sciences Würzburg-Schweinfurt (Germany), University College Cork (Ireland), University of Tartu (Estonia), and VID Specialized University (Norway).
The programme consists of workshops and collaborative online teamwork with an intensive week in Helsinki on 27.-31.5.2024.
